Great question and an area we have to make clearer in Beta 2.0 coming out in March.

 

Share is meant-to be a place you can do just that, share anything.  It doesn't have to be related to the Tools program.  It could be a movie you just watched, a great recipe, or anything else.  Of course it can also be Tools Related as well.

 

Where a blog is intended to be a personal journal of your experiences in your life while you are going through the program.  

 

However, as with-everything in Tools, it is about you, so in the end of the day, it is up to you!
